Process for forming a graded index optical material and structures formed thereby
First Claim
1. A process for depositing on the surface of a substrate a layer of a chosen material in which the index of refraction of said layer varies in a predetermined continuous and periodic pattern as a function of the thickness of said layer, comprising the steps of:
- (a) providing said substrate;
(b) providing first and second selected vapor phase reactants which react upon inducement by radiation of a selected wavelength to form said chosen material which deposits on said substrate;
(c) exposing said substrate to said first and second vapor phase reactants in predetermined proportions in the presence of said radiation to deposit said chosen material having a first predetermined stoichiometric composition and a first predetermined index of refraction;
(d) altering said predetermined proportions of said first and second vapor phase reactants as a function of time in a continuous manner to correspondingly alter in a continuous manner said stoichiometric composition and said index of refraction of said chosen material deposited as a function of time and to thereby produce said graded index of refraction in said chosen material; and
(e) repeating said altering of step "d" for the number of times required to produce said variation of said refractive index in said predetermined continuous and periodic pattern as a function of said thickness of said layer.

Abstract
A process for depositing on the surface of a substrate a layer of a chosen material having continuous gradations in refractive index in a predetermined periodic pattern. The substrate is exposed to two vapor phase reactants which react upon radiation-inducement to produce the chosen material, and the relative proportion of the reactants is varied in a predetermined and continuous sequence to produce continuous gradations in the stoichiometric composition and refractive index of the deposited layer as a function of thickness. Additionally, predetermined changes in refractive index and/or thickness across the horizontal surface of the substrate may be produced in combination with the change in refractive index as a function of thickness. Diffraction optical elements formed by such a process include various optical filters and reflective optical coatings.
